At Maxar, our next generation spacecraft range from Earth observation to interplanetary missions, including NASA's Artemis Program Lunar Gateway Power and Propulsion Element (PPE). We are looking for a Hardware Test Engineer to join our growing Space Program Delivery team. This position provides an opportunity to participate in fast-paced iterative Avionics Hardware developments for Command & Data Handling systems, with an emphasis in proliferated LEO constellations applications.In this role, you will act as the first line of defense in our verification and validation efforts for different Space Infrastructure products. Collaborating closely with a cohort of electrical, mechanical, and system engineers, you will develop test plans, build test rigs, and execute test activities in the laboratory for R&D and Qualification campaigns. This is an exciting opportunity to be hands-on with flight hardware and it will rely on a solid foundation on engineering to ensure that our avionics products are ready for launch.Responsibilities:- Plan and execute tests and verification activities on a suite of avionics products both for R&D and qualification purposes
- Design and build test rigs with the necessary requirements for a full verification of the flight hardware
- Develop electrical schematics, mechanical drawings and software scripts for test automation
- Review and synthesize test data to troubleshoot design issues and provide potential solutions to the Design Engineers
- Interface with Hardware, Firmware and Software Engineers to understand the designs and ensure that they incorporate Design-for-Verification best practices.
